Stettler men charged in canola theft going to trial

Dec 9, 2022 | 2:07 PM

A trial date has been set for two people facing more than a dozen charges each following the theft of a large amount of canola this fall.

Jesse James Lyman MacDonald, 33, of Stettler, along with Tristan James Ruby, 36, also of Stettler, are both scheduled for trial in Stettler provincial court on May 11, 2023.

It was in the early morning hours of Sept. 28, 2022, when Bashaw RCMP received a report that a significant amount of canola was stolen from a farm in Camrose County. Bashaw RCMP and members of the Central Alberta Crime Reduction Unit (CAD CRU) were deployed to the area.

At approximately 1:30 p.m., Bashaw RCMP then received a report of suspicious individuals attempting to sell canola. RCMP located a vehicle and grain truck suspected in the thefts. Bashaw RCMP and CAD CRU officers successfully arrested the driver of the vehicle in Mirror, AB. Upon searching the vehicle, officers located a loaded 12-gauge shot gun.

At the same time, officers from RCMP CAD CRU, supported by Bashaw and Stettler RCMP, attempted to do a traffic stop with the grain truck. The driver failed to stop for officers. Eventually, officers successfully deployed a tire deflation device on the grain truck and with the assistance of an RCMP helicopter and Police Dog Services. The driver was arrested.

As a result of the investigation, a stolen grain auger, a firearm, and a significant amount of canola were recovered.

Jesse James Lyman MacDonald was charged with a total of 14 counts, some of which include:

  • Flight from Peace Officer
  • Obstructing a Peace Officer
  • Possession of a weapon for a dangerous purpose
  • Trafficking in property obtained by crime

Tristan James Ruby, 36, was charged with a total of 16 counts, some of which include:

  • Being unlawfully at large (x9)
  • Possession of a weapon for a dangerous purpose
  • Trafficking in property obtained by crime
